Lloyds Bank Foundation for England and Wales is an independent charitable foundation, backed by Lloyds Banking Group and the people within it. We want everyone to be in a good place - personally, in a home that’s a good place to live, and in a community that’s a good place to belong.
We back people and communities across England and Wales, to make that happen, because when you back brilliant people, brilliant things happen. Our communities are full of ambitious, energetic and determined people stepping up to make their neighbours’ lives better and their communities grow stronger. Day in, day out.
We play our role by connecting and catalysing community-led change, providing the money, time, tools and connections that build organisations’ capacity and capability, to make people’s lives better and their communities stronger.

We're a Disability Confident (Level 2) employer, a Living Wage Employer, and we work hard to make sure every member of our team feels valued, supported and able to thrive. We offer a comprehensive benefits package, because whoever you are and wherever you're coming from, we want you to be in a good place when working with us.
We want everyone who works at Lloyds Bank Foundation to be in a good place, and that means making sure you have everything you need to thrive at work. Here's what we offer:
Generous annual leave of 33 to 38 days (inc. statutory)
Winter closure (additional 2-3 days)
Hybrid and Flexible Working
Pension scheme with up to 13% employer contribution
Private medical insurance covering dental, eyecare and mental health
Employee family leave entitlement
Employee Assistance Programme
Life Assurance
Two paid volunteering days per year
Cycle to Work Scheme
